SBI Overview
State Bank of India (SBI) an Indian multinational, public sector bank with its headquarters in Mumbai. SBI is one of the oldest banks in the history of baking industry and is the 43rd largest bank in the world. SBI conducts examinations every year to recruit millions of candidates for various posts, across India. Since it is an established public sector bank, working in SBI is considered to be one of the most reputed jobs. It also guarantees job security and a lucrative pay scale. Vacancies for Various SBI Exams
The SBI official notification mentions the number of vacancies released for each and every post. The same can be checked by the aspirants through the official notification released on the official portal. State Bank of India conducts the recruitment of SBI officers and personnel for different competitive bank exams. Given below is the list of SBI exams along with the number of vacancies in 2019:
SBI PO Vacancy – 2,000 vacancies
SBI Clerk Vacancy – 8,653 regular vacancies
SBI SO Vacancy – 579 vacancies
The vacancies for 2020 have not been released yet but we can expect the same number of vacancies for each post, for this year as well. The vacancies might increase or decrease in number, hence it is always recommended to check for further updates and notification from SBI.
SBI Exam Eligibility Criteria
It is very important to check for the eligibility criteria before applying for the examination. A candidate should be aware whether he or she does fall under the eligible category so that the application has no chance of getting rejected afterwards.
The important Eligibility details for various SBI exams are given below:
-
SBI PO Exam Eligibility
-
Nationality: Candidate should be a citizen of India
-
Educational Qualification: Candidate should be a graduate in ay stream from any recognised university or college
-
Age Limit: Candidate should not be below 21 years of age and not more than 30 years as on 1st April 2020. However, some category-wise age relaxation is provided.
-
Number of attempts: The number of attempts for the general category is 4. The number of attempts is also specified for other categories like for OBC it is 7 and for SC/ST, there is no restriction.
-
SBI Clerk Exam Eligibility
-
Nationality: A candidate should be a citizen of India
-
Educational Qualification: A candidate should be graduated in any discipline from a recognised college or university.
-
Age Limit: Candidates applying for the post of clerical should not be below 20 years of age and not above 28 years as on 1St April 2020.
-
SBI SO Exam eligibility
-
Nationality: The Candidate should be a citizen of India
-
Educational Qualification: The candidate should be a graduate or post graduate from a recognised university.
-
Age Limit: The candidate should not be more than 40 years of age.

FAQ’s
Q1) I am in the final year of graduation. Can I apply for the SBI exams?
Candidates who are in the Final Year of their Graduation may also apply provisionally with the exception that, if called for interview, they will have to produce proof of having passed the graduation examination.
Q2) Does graduation marks matter in the SBI exams?
No, there is no minimum percentage of marks required in graduation. No such condition has been laid down for the eligibility criteria.
Q3) Is there any bond in SBI exams?
The selected candidates, will have to submit a bond of Rs 2 lakhs at the time of joining. The bond shall state that they will have to serve SBI for a minimum period of three years.
Q4) Are the SBI Exams Bilingual?
Yes, all the prelims and mains exams are bilingual, except for the English Descriptive Test which has to be compulsorily in English.
Q5) Are the SBI exams tough?
Since they are national-level competitive exams, they have a standard level of difficulty. A large number of candidates apply for this post every year.
